> Bruce Momjian wrote:
> > > If somebody wants to see an applications querystring (at
> > > least the first 512 bytes) just in case something goes wrong
> > > and the client hangs, he'd have to run querystring reporting
> > > all the time either way.
> >
> > Agreed. That should be on all the time.
> >
> > > So I can see value in a per database default in pg_database
> > > plus the ability to switch it on/off via statement to analyze
> > > single commands.
> >
> > Sounds fine. You may be able to just to a GUC/SET option and not do a
> > per-database field. GUC doesn't do per-database and having a database
> > flag and GUC would be confusing. Let's roll with just GUC/SET and see
> > how it goes.
>
> No per backend on/off statement - is that what you mean?
> That'd be easiest to get started.

GUC as the default, and SET for per-backend. I am liking GUC more and
more.
